A jaunty stroll through Pepperland discussing The Beatles & solo Beatle albums with a pot pourri of delicious guests.

The I am the EggPod podcasts aim to bring a lighthearted side to the Beatles (and solo Beatles) studio albums, with a series of amazing guests.

If you’re after facts, figures, numbers and data, then you may wish to explore other podcasts. These podcasts are the equivalent of sitting in a pub, chatting and chewing the fat.

The shows are hosted by Chris Shaw who can be found on Twitter at @ChrisShawEditor

EggPodders from across the globe share their thoughts and feelings about the new Beatles single 'Now and Then'. Hosted by Chris Shaw.
On 26th October 2023 it was announced that The Beatles were releasing a new song, Now and Then, as well as remixed - and expanded - Red and Blue  albums. In a live interactive online stream Chris Shaw discussed what  we might be able to expect, along with listeners Rob Manuel, Dom Reid,  Dan Chisholm, Rob Lawes and Edward Rhodes.
